Jeju Island, often called the "Hawaii of Korea," is a volcanic island known for its breathtaking landscapes, unique culture, and tranquil charm. Home to dramatic lava tubes, stunning waterfalls, lush hiking trails on Hallasan Mountain, and pristine beaches, Jeju is a haven for nature lovers and adventurers alike. Beyond its natural beauty, the island offers quirky museums, traditional thatched villages, and a slower pace of life that contrasts with mainland Korea. Whether you're exploring lava caves, tasting fresh seafood, or enjoying coastal walks, Jeju is the perfect escape into Korea’s wild and wonderful side.
